European markets continue to exhibit caution amid the interplay of geopolitical tensions and forthcoming central bank rate decisions. Speculation regarding a potential U.S. intervention in the Middle East has caused unease among investors, overshadowing anticipated discussions on monetary policies.
This week, attention is centered on a series of central bank meetings across Europe and the U.S., where guidance on economic outlooks and interest rate strategies is eagerly awaited.
Market Volatility and Key Factors
The current geopolitical uncertainties have triggered increased volatility in both equity and currency markets. Traders are particularly concerned about:
- The impact of geopolitical conflicts on global supply chains
- Fluctuations in energy prices
Simultaneously, central banks are assessing inflation developments and economic growth indicators to decide whether to maintain, increase, or adjust interest rates.
